Ranger puts all-analog overdrive behind a straightforward Gain, Tone, and Level layout. The Hi/Lo toggle provides two distinct approaches: Hi brings in more top end and clean signal for a pick-sensitive response, while Lo moves toward a more saturated drive. True-bypass switching keeps the pedal simple to integrate into a rig, and the illuminated Maestro logo gives a clear active indication when the pedal is engaged.
